在 powershell ISE 中,我们可以运行从脚本中定义的模块加载的 cmdlet。但相同的脚本无法在 powershell 控制台上运行。
请告诉我如何使它在与 ISE 相同的控制台中工作。
谢谢,
答案1
需要检查的一件事是您的配置文件脚本。ISE 和控制台对配置文件脚本使用不同的文件规范。您可以使用您喜欢的编辑器编辑配置文件脚本,如下所示:
> notepad $profile
如果您的 ISE $profile 定义了您的 Console $profile 未定义的一些内容,那么这可能是导致不同行为的原因。